Cybersecurity Perspectives: Systems Lifecycle Management Approach
One way to approach cybersecurity is through the system development lifecycle (SDLC) management approach. Using SDLC, one begins cybersecurity planning along with requirements formation during the requirements (or initiation) phase. As well as identifying and prioritizing user-based functional requirements and systems technical requirements [1], organizations should address data privacy issues, confidentiality, authentication, nonrepudiation, and other aspects of the data and information the proposed system will utilize. Both information and systems owners should be collaboratively and objectively involved. At this stage, it is also important to understand the potential threats to which the proposed system will be exposed in light of the system's known and potential vulnerabilities and to begin the initial planning of how to test cybersecurity requirements against the proposed system during the system testing phase.
